Hardik Pandya suffers quadriceps injury in Asia Cup 2025

Hardik Pandya
Axar Patel and Hardik Pandya are all smiles

Hardik Pandya injured his left quadriceps during a group round play against Sri Lanka at the Asia Cup 2025. Following that, he was ruled out of the final match against Pakistan.

However, he contributed significantly to India’s triumph in the Asia Cup 2025. He was also unavailable for the Australian white-ball tour because of his ailment. The all-rounder is undergoing rehabilitation at the BCCI’s Centre of Excellence (CoE) in Bengaluru for the next four weeks.
